Welcome to on-call for the Glimmerpane design system! Our snapshot tests live in the `snapcheck` suite and run on every merge to main. If a UI component changes visually, the diff bot flags it — usually it's an intentional tweak, so just approve the new baseline. If it's 2am and snapshots are failing across the board, it's almost always a font-loading race, not your problem. To unlock the baseline store and re-approve snapshots in bulk, use the recovery passphrase below.

recovery phrase for tahag-taguf: wenix-caswyn

**Alert: TilePuller prefetch queue saturated**

Hey plugin folks — the TilePuller prefetcher in Cartogrove is dropping low-priority map-tile requests again. If your plugin queues more than 200 tiles per viewport change, expect silent evictions. Batch your requests or mark them deferrable. We're working on backpressure signals for the next release. Details and current queue limits are documented on this page.

operations page: https://jenkins.zemvarcloud.local/job/merge_requests/repo/build/73930b4b30f0a8ed

## Ticket: Partitioning config drift between prod and staging

We partition the `events` table by month in Ledgewise, but staging drifted: it's still creating partitions with the old quarterly scheme after someone hand-edited the migration runner in March. Future maintainers, please don't patch partitioning settings directly on hosts — drift like this breaks our restore drills. I've reconciled staging back to monthly and re-ran the partition creator. For reference, the canonical settings now in effect are listed below.

service settings:
[quenath]
host = quenath.zemvarcorp.corp
user = quenath_svc
database = quenath_prod

Eng sync notes — flaky tests in PayBramble

The integration suite for PayBramble is still flaking, mostly the settlement webhook tests timing out under parallel runs. We're quarantining the worst three and adding a fake clock to kill the race. Target: green builds by next Friday. If your PR gets blocked by a flake, ping the owner of the stabilization effort, named below.

signatory, hahap-yahog: Lamius Novmir Pelix